Minnesota was 1 win away (either Northwestern or Cal) from being about #30 in the final polls. So it's not wild at all to think they at least rise to that level with a lot of returning players and a QB with a year of experience.
The 2026 schedule is mostly favorable. The two traditional powers (Michigan, Penn State) were both down last year and are replacing coaches. Indiana appears to be the doomsday game. Iowa is still a big hurdle until we start seeing more wins in that series.
The potential risk for next year is that 2025 Minnesota had a better record than the eye test and the stats. Close wins, blowout losses, and most of the wins piled up against the bottom 5-6 teams in the league.
